Finding the Right Fit: Oldage Homes vs. Assisted Living

Deciding where to spend your later years can be the difficult choice. Many people blur together retirement homes and assisted living – and understanding the key differences is essential. Retirement homes typically offer lodging and amenities for relatively self-sufficient seniors, whereas assisted living provides extra care with daily activities, such as bathing, meds, and dining. Ultimately, the best location depends on an person’s unique needs and support level.

Assisted Living Facilities: What to Expect and How to Choose

Considering a assisted living facility ? It's important to know what to anticipate and how to pick a option. Usually , these places offer support with everyday activities , like dressing, food preparation, and medication management.
